BOWMORE magnetic Board code and TDEM overview on its property of Saint-Victor

MONTREAL, QUEBEC--(Marketwire-November 26, 2010)-BOWMORE Exploration Ltd. (TSX VENTURE: BOW) ("Bowmore") is pleased to announce that it has contract Geophysics GPR International Inc., Montreal, Quebec, to conduct a survey of helicopter-borne geophysical on its 100% owned "Saint-Victor" located within the Southern Appalachian of Québec. The property that is inside a wide belt of sediment was targeted for the storage of near-surface type, large tonnage. The survey will consist of magnetic and (TDEM) time domain electromagnetic survey that covers an area of over 27,000 acres for a total of km 2410 flown. The survey of high-resolution aeromagnetic is designed to identify the main geological structures, contacts and conductors potential related to gold mineralized zones identified previously (see press release October 12). The survey will begin today and should be completed within 4-6 days.

Bowmore will incorporate the new data with existing geological mapping and exploration results to generate an interpretation that will be used to determine the peak program is scheduled for January 2011.

Mr. Paul Dumas, President of Bowmore, stated that "we are pleased to move quickly with the airborne survey before vacation. taking into account the size of our property and an area that we need to cover, the survey will help us to establish our flagship program that is scheduled for early 2011".

The technical information contained in this press release were approved by Brigitte Dejou p. Eng., Qualified Person as defined by Canadian NI 43-101.
